The LG G3 Stylus and G3 Beat
The LG G3 Stylus, LG’s new pen-enabled smartphone that inherits the core DNA of the LG G3, brings a premium stylus experience in a smart priced package. 

LG’s proprietary RubberdiumTM stylus pen slides inside the G3 Stylus, which feels comfortable in any hand and complements the phone’s 5.5-inch large display. Users can pair it with LG’s QuickMemo+ to take notes or draw directly on images or maps in a breeze. The stylus is also compatible with a number of third-party handwriting and drawing apps.
The LG G3 Beat retains the best features and functions of the G3 in a more compact and handy package. A testament that less can be more, the LG G3 Beat comes with a largest-in-class 5.0-inch HD IPS display with a screen-to-body ratio of 74.1 percent, the highest in the mid-tier smartphone segment. 

The LG G3 Beat offers impressively thin bezels and a robust 2,540mAh battery. It features the Floating Arc Design first unveiled on the LG G3, boasting smooth curved sides and gradually tapered edges for the ultimate comfort in grip and feel. 

Both the G3 Beat and G3 Stylus’ 8MP and 13MP shooters, respectively, carry over the G3’s key camera features such as Touch & Shoot, Gesture Shot and Front Camera Light. Additional UX features that have become standard offerings across LG’s newest smartphones include Dual Window, Smart Keyboard and Knock CodeTM. Both also have the same Floating Arc design with gradually tapered edges, thin bezels and metallic skin back cover that was first introduced on the LG G3. Both devices also sport the revolutionary rear key.

The LG G Watch R
Smart comes in full circle with the new LG G Watch R, which has already garnered global praises for its stylish look, inspired by classical and premium experiences, and smooth and speedy performance.  This is the world’s first watch-style wearable to feature a fully circular Plastic OLED (P-OLED) display at 1.3 inches, taking advantage of every pixel and producing images of stunning color and accurate viewing at all angles even under bright sunlight.

LG G Watch R features a classic design encased in durable stainless steel and aluminum powered by a 410mAh battery, the largest in an Android Wearable to date.  It delivers optimal performance through its powerful but efficient 1.2GHz Qualcomm® Snapdragon™ 400 processor with 4GB of storage and 512MB of RAM, and is completely protected from dust and water resistant for up to 30 minutes at a maximum depth of one meter.

Other impressive features of the LG G Watch R, when paired with a smartphone, include information on weather forecast, real-time traffic conditions, turn-by turn navigations, stock market updates, social media notifications, and travel and restaurant updates.  The device also allows the user to track fitness goals and use the Ok Google feature to send a text message, email, or play songs through the Android WearTM music.
